SQLsubqueryscalartutorial

O que é uma subconsulta escalar em SQL? Um único valor no SELECT para iniciantes

Uma subconsulta escalar é um SELECT que retorna exatamente um valor e se encaixa na posição de uma coluna ou em uma expressão WHERE. Em palavras simples: extrair um campo de uma tabela relacionada, adicionar um número de resumo a cada linha de um relatório, usá-la como constante em uma condição. Com tabelas e erros comuns.

1 min de leituraSQL · subquery · scalar · tutorial

Uma subconsulta escalar é um SELECT que retorna exatamente um valor — uma linha, uma coluna. Você a coloca na posição de uma coluna, em uma expressão WHERE ou em uma atribuição SET, e o Postgres substitui pelo resultado.

Este artigo está atualmente em russo. A tradução completa para o inglês está a caminho.

Pratique com exercícios reais

Resolva exercícios no treinador de SQL com correção instantânea e dicas.

Abrir o treinador